Overview

Investigates how changing GPR110 levels affects behavior in adult mice, suggesting new approaches for mental health disorders.

Key Points

  • To examine the impact of GPR110 expression on behavior and molecular pathways in adult mice.
  • Used mice with GPR110 deletion and overexpression in glutamatergic neurons
  • Conducted behavioral testing in open field and learning tasks
  • Performed transcriptomic and proteomic analyses of brain tissues
  • Deletion of GPR110 increased immobility in behavioral tests and impaired learning
  • Downregulation of genes involved in synaptogenesis and neurotransmission observed
  • Overexpression of GPR110 reduced anxiety and compulsive behaviors, enhancing receptor signaling and synaptic communication
